Specialist, Enterprise Business Services

WalmartBentonville, AR
$19 - $35Onsite

About The Position

The Specialist, Enterprise Business Services plays a critical role in supporting business strategies by analyzing initiatives, interpreting data, and providing actionable recommendations aligned with organizational goals. This position ensures compliance with applicable laws and company policies while managing complex customer service issues and benefits administration. The role involves coordinating with multiple stakeholders to resolve escalated concerns, maintaining system security and access, and supporting technical equipment and software needs. The specialist contributes to continuous improvement efforts and fosters effective communication to enhance operational performance and service delivery. The Enterprise Business Services team supports business operations through data analysis, regulatory compliance, and effective communication. Collaborating with management and partners, the team drives process improvements, enforces policy adherence, and executes key initiatives. Members provide administrative support, conduct quality control, and facilitate training to maintain high standards. The team upholds integrity, accountability, and continuous improvement, delivering accurate insights and supporting compliance efforts. This professional environment encourages collaboration and growth, enabling the achievement of business objectives aligned with Walmart’s standards.

  • Live Better U is a Walmart-paid education benefit program for full-time and part-time associates in Walmart and Sam's Club facilities. Programs range from high school completion to bachelor's degrees, including English Language Learning and short-form certificates. Tuition, books, and fees are completely paid for by Walmart.
